Traditions and Superstitions Behind Tears

Tears on a wedding day are also woven with threads of tradition and superstition. In many cultures, it’s believed that tears shed during the ceremony are a good omen, symbolizing the washing away of past sorrows and the purging of any bad luck. By crying, you’re not only following a long-standing superstition but also acknowledging the significance of the transition you’re making into a new phase of life with your partner.

The Impact of the First Look

The first look is a relatively new tradition where you and your partner see each other before the ceremony. This intimate moment can range from calming nerves to intensifying the excitement of the day. It’s often seen as a private opportunity to connect and cherish each other’s presence. When you see your bride in her dress for the first time, the realization that your dream of marriage is about to come true can be overwhelming and can explain why some grooms cry during this pivotal moment.
